Improve decision making with social principles and technologies

Decision making processes that involve multiple parties and multiple perspectives can be lengthy and cumbersome, and consensus decisions are often elusive. Embracing social principles such as participation, openness, transparency and dialog and using social collaboration practices and tools to support collaborative decision-making, it is likely that much of the decision making in organizations can be improved both in terms of process and outcome.
